Corporate Transparency Act Reporting: Off Again (For Now)

March 31, 2025

The Corporate Transparency Act (CTA) requires most small businesses to file a report identifying their Beneficial Ownership Information (BOI). Various entities were exempted from this requirement, including those in certain industries and those with more than 20 employees and $5 million in revenues. The original deadline to file was December 31, 2023, but that deadline was postponed to the end of 2024. In the period from December 2024 through March 2025, a flurry of court decisions and Treasury Department announcements resulted in the deadline being canceled and re-scheduled several times, sometimes only days apart.

On March 2 the Treasury Department announced that it was suspending enforcement of the reporting requirements with respect to all US persons and companies. The announcement also said that the Department would issue a proposed new rule to narrow enforcement of the CTA to apply only to foreign persons and entities. On March 21, the proposed new rule was published. It is now open for public comment for 60 days before final action can be taken. As a result, the Treasury Department is now telling US companies and persons that they are not required to file BOI reports…at least for now.
